1. Specifications Comparison
Design
Feature | ZTE nubia Red Magic 6 | Xiaomi Poco X6 | Practical Impact |
Dimensions | 169.9 × 77.2 × 9.7 mm | 161.2 × 74.3 × 8 mm | The Poco X6 is noticeably smaller and thinner, making it more pocketable and easier to handle, especially for smaller hands. |
Weight | 220g | 181g | The Poco X6 is significantly lighter, making it more comfortable for extended use and less tiring to hold for longer periods. |
Display
Feature | ZTE nubia Red Magic 6 | Xiaomi Poco X6 | Practical Impact |
Size | 6.8" | 6.67" | The Red Magic 6 provides a slightly larger viewing area, which may be preferable for media consumption and gaming. |
Resolution | 1080x2400 | 1220x2712 | The Poco X6 has a sharper, clearer display due to its higher resolution, offering more detail and clarity, especially for text and images. |
Pixel Density (PPI) | 387 | 446 | The higher PPI of the Poco X6 results in a noticeably crisper display with finer details and less pixelation. |
Technology | AMOLED | AMOLED | Both have vibrant colors and deep blacks, which are great for media consumption, gaming, and general use. |
Refresh Rate | 165Hz | 120Hz | The Red Magic 6 has a much higher refresh rate providing smoother animations in games and scrolling, resulting in a more fluid user experience. |
Brightness | 0 nits | 1800 nits | The Poco X6 offers vastly superior visibility in bright sunlight, making it much more practical for outdoor use. |
Performance
Feature | ZTE nubia Red Magic 6 | Xiaomi Poco X6 | Practical Impact |
Chipset | Qualcomm Snapdragon 888 5G (5 nm) | Qualcomm Snapdragon 7s Gen 2 (4 nm) | The Snapdragon 888 is older but was a flagship processor. The 7s Gen 2 is newer and more power-efficient, likely providing strong daily performance and good gaming. |
AnTuTu Score | N/A | 603,400 | Lack of Red Magic 6 score prevents direct comparison. Poco X6's score indicates good mid-range performance. |
GPU | Adreno 660 | Adreno 710 | The Adreno 710 is a more modern GPU. While direct performance differences require testing, the Adreno 710 is likely more efficient for gaming, but this is highly variable across different workloads. |
